According to the 7th edition of the tumour-node-metastasis TNM staging system the International Association for the Study of Lung Cancer IASLC reclassified pleural dissemination from T4 to M1 including malignant pleural or pericardial effusions and pleural nodules.

Stage IV NSCLC cannot be cured but treatment can reduce pain ease breathing and extend and improve quality of life. Malignant pleural effusion was considered a T4 stage IIIB lesion inthe 1985 revision thus implying that patients with malignant pleuraleffusion had a more favorable prognosis than did patients with M1 stage IV disease.

Malignant pleural effusion MPE affects 150000 people in the US and over 250000 people in Europe each year and it represents a common finding up to 15 in the advanced stage cancers Lung cancer in men and breast cancer in women account for 5065 of all MPE followed by ovarian metastatic cancer hematological malignancies and malignant pleural.
